"Downton Abbey" star Michelle Dockery's boyfriend, John Dineen, has died after reportedly battling a rare form of cancer. He was 34.

According to ITV News, Dineen died Sunday morning at a hospice in Cork, Ireland, just two days before Dockery's 34 birthday.

"The family is very grateful for the support and kindness they have received but would kindly request that they are left to grieve in private," Dockery's spokesperson said in a statement to ITV News.

Dineen, a senior director at London-based FTI consulting, began dating Dockery after her "Downton Abbey" co-star Allen Leech introduced them in September 2013. Some reports say the couple was engaged.

Dockery was recently in the United States to promote the final season of "Downton Abbey," but reportedly flew to Ireland to be by Dineen's bedside.

According to E! News, a private funeral will be held on Wednesday, Dec. 16.
